Default Approach to Winner take all tourneys.

Im thinking about joining a 1 table satelite that is winner take all. should i be approaching this differently than a regular sng? obviously i need 1st, nothing else is worth it. What changes (if any) should i make for this type of format? thanks

Taking a coinflip to double up is MUCH more valuable. In general big gambles go up in value.
